Job description

Responsibilities

Job Summary: The Pharmacy Provider Specialist will serve as a liaison to medical practice groups and to provide administrative and clinical support in closing gaps in pharmaceutical care such as medication nonadherence. In tandem with other Prominence representatives, this position will develop relationships with medical practice groups and serve as their subject matter expert on pharmacy benefits. Will interface with members thru home visits and telephonically and with pharmacies to support internal departments to improve performance in the organization's Star Rating program. This position will resolve member-level barriers to medication nonadherence and provide member-level and provider-level solutions to close gaps in care. Will perform other duties as needed related to coordination with medical provider practice groups.
